Transaction 77e139e60e530b6dafafb8e80cb497458f4a23a87288241efb089f0360321938

1 Input
2 Outputs
  • 77e139e60e530b6dafafb8e80cb497458f4a23a87288241efb089f0360321938:0
  • value  1303118
    address  3FakipfzCmyKqSP4iUgMtYZKHuT4AGGBdG
  • 77e139e60e530b6dafafb8e80cb497458f4a23a87288241efb089f0360321938:1
  • value  2882382
    address  1K6jeUGaqg4xewSuMRP2gxqCBjcybfvLCp